Created attachment 1446563 [details] screenshot Description of problem: As shown in the attached screenshots,you are unable to switch to userC from userA,as there is no "switch user" option in the list. Actually,there is when you add userB after do a fresh installation, but the system will just hang there after you click the "switch user" button and type in userB's password,please see the attached screencast for more information,thanks. FYI,I'm able to login with userB,after logout from userA session. okay,I lied,you can switch to userB if you wait long enough on the first boot of a fresh install ,but there is not 'switch user' option in userB's list and you can not login as userA after you logout from userB.And after the first boot there is no 'switch user' any more.

Still see this bug with Fedora-Workstation-Live-x86_64-29-20180904.n.0.iso [lnie@localhost ~]$ rpm -q kernel gnome-shell kernel-4.18.5-300.fc29.x86_64 gnome-shell-3.29.91-1.fc29.x86_64
It looks like the AccountsService package doesn't include the patch from https://bugs.freedesktop.org/show_bug.cgi?id=107298.
Proposed as a Blocker for 29-final by Fedora user lnie using the blocker tracking app because: seems affect the criteria:Switched layouts when unlocked encrypted storage,as https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/QA:Testcase_desktop_login is listed here
Discussed during the 2018-09-17 blocker review meeting: [1] The decision to classify this bug as a "RejectedBlocker" was made as the blocker criteria do not cover user switching, so this bug does not violate any them.
